In that case, though, you're assigning self.b > twice. If it is a descriptor, that might not be desirable and result in all > kinds of side effects. > 1. The combination of a non-idempotent descriptor and wanting to customise the input in `__init__` seems very rare. Since this is a convenience, I think it's fine to not support every use case. 2. The problem can be solved by putting the customisation in the descriptor, which is probably a good idea anyway. 3. A user would have to be particularly careless to do this by mistake and cause actual damage. It should be obvious from both a brief description of the decorator and some basic experimentation that it assigns to descriptors. A simple test of the user's actual code would also likely reveal this.
